Why Choose a Luxury Cruise for Seniors?
Cruising is often considered the ultimate way to travel, especially for those looking for relaxation and ease. Here are a few reasons why luxury cruises are ideal for senior travelers:
- All-Inclusive Comfort
Luxury cruises offer all-inclusive packages that cover everything from accommodation and meals to entertainment and excursions. For older travelers, this means fewer worries about planning logistics or handling the stress of finding a new place to eat or stay every day. You can simply unpack once and enjoy the journey. - Medical Assistance Onboard
Many luxury cruise lines offer medical facilities onboard staffed by doctors and nurses who can attend to any health concerns. This is especially important for elderly travelers who may have specific medical needs or feel more at ease knowing that professional help is available at sea. - Accessibility and Mobility Services
Modern luxury cruise ships are designed with accessibility in mind. Features like elevators, wheelchair-accessible rooms, and spacious public areas ensure that seniors with mobility challenges can move around comfortably. Some cruise lines even provide mobility aids, such as scooters and wheelchairs, to help guests get around with ease. - Personalized Services and Care
Many luxury cruise lines go the extra mile to make seniors feel like royalty. From personal concierges to 24/7 room service, the level of attention and service ensures that every guest is well taken care of. This can make all the difference in creating a stress-free, enjoyable experience. - Relaxing Itinerary
Luxury cruises offer a variety of itineraries, from relaxing days at sea to exciting stops at beautiful destinations. For seniors looking for a more laid-back trip, there are cruises with plenty of days spent at sea, allowing guests to enjoy the cruise’s luxurious amenities without the rush of packed schedules.
Top Elder-Friendly Luxury Cruises
Here are some cruise lines that stand out for their elder-friendly services and luxurious offerings:
1. Viking Ocean Cruises
Viking is renowned for its relaxed yet refined approach to cruising. The ships are designed to accommodate seniors with features like step-free access, easy-to-navigate decks, and staterooms with large bathrooms. Viking also offers enrichment programs, such as lectures and performances, that cater to intellectual and cultural interests. Whether cruising in the Mediterranean or the Baltic, Viking promises an elegant and relaxing experience.
2. Cunard Line
Cunard’s luxury ships are known for their classic elegance and exceptional service. With a focus on traditional cruising experiences, Cunard offers spacious staterooms and suites, perfect for elderly travelers who want to enjoy comfort and style. The line provides special amenities like a dedicated senior desk for assistance and personalized services tailored to guests’ needs.
3. Regent Seven Seas Cruises
Regent is a top choice for those seeking ultra-luxury. Their all-inclusive packages include gourmet dining, shore excursions, beverages, and gratuities, giving you peace of mind knowing everything is taken care of. With a range of accessibility features and attentive staff, Regent provides a comfortable, luxurious environment for older travelers. The line is known for its smaller, more intimate ships, which can be ideal for seniors who prefer a more relaxed atmosphere.
4. Princess Cruises
Princess Cruises offers an exceptional array of activities, such as yoga and fitness programs tailored for seniors. The line also offers fully accessible cabins and mobility aids to ensure ease of movement throughout the ship. Princess offers slower-paced shore excursions, such as scenic bus tours or easy walks, perfect for elderly travelers who want to explore but at a comfortable pace.
5. Oceania Cruises
Oceania is another fantastic option for older travelers seeking a luxury experience at sea. Their ships are designed to provide an intimate, personalized cruising experience, with smaller passenger capacities and exceptional service. With a range of wellness programs and enrichment activities, seniors can enjoy a vacation that is both relaxing and intellectually stimulating.
Elder-Friendly Amenities You Should Look For
When considering a luxury cruise, it’s important to check that the ship offers the right amenities and services for older travelers. Here’s a list of some key features that can make the trip more enjoyable:
- Accessible Cabins: Look for cabins with wider doors, grab bars, and accessible showers. Some cruise lines offer rooms specifically designed for mobility-impaired guests.
- Medical Services: Ensure the ship has a well-equipped medical center with qualified medical personnel. This is a must-have for older travelers who may have specific health concerns.
- Shore Excursions: Choose a cruise line that offers shore excursions that cater to different mobility levels, such as guided bus tours, accessible walks, and cultural activities.
- Assistance with Embarkation and Disembarkation: Some cruise lines offer priority boarding for seniors and those with mobility issues, making the embarkation and disembarkation process smoother and less stressful.
- Wellness and Spa Services: Many luxury cruise lines offer spa and wellness programs that are tailored to senior travelers, including gentle yoga classes, massage therapies, and other relaxation treatments.
